How Surat Stays Connected Abroad

Surat is possibly the most trade-oriented city in India after Mumbai, and that commercial intensity extends to its international calling patterns. The diamond polishing and textile industries have made Surat a node in global supply chains, with active business contacts in Antwerp, New York, Hong Kong and Dubai. Calls from Surat's Ring Road offices and the diamond bourse district are not just family calls โ€” they are working conversations between buyers, cutters, exporters and brokers, conducted on tight schedules with an eye on the clock and the per-minute cost. Gujarati carriers follow the statewide Jio-dominant pattern, but Surat's business class has adopted Airtel postpaid at higher rates than surrounding cities because reliability matters more to them than to a purely domestic prepaid user. ISD packs for Belgium, the US and UAE are all used in this city in ways that would be unusual elsewhere. The diamond trade alone creates a calling corridor to Antwerp that has no equivalent in any other Indian city at any similar scale.

Surat's Global Connections

Surat's diamond industry has placed communities of Surat-origin traders in Antwerp, New York and Dubai; these networks are tightly maintained through calls, visits and family-to-family business arrangements. The broader Gujarati merchant tradition means the UK โ€” Leicester and East London in particular โ€” has families with Surat origins alongside those from Ahmedabad and Vadodara. The UAE is a major destination both for the business class and for garment industry workers from the city's textile belt. More recently, Canada has drawn students from Surat's Jain and Hindu business families. The mix of blue-collar labour migration and high-value business travel in the same city creates an unusually wide range of calling destinations for a place of this size.

Telecommunications in Bahrain

Bahrain boasts a robust telecommunications infrastructure, with both landline and mobile services widely available. The country is serviced primarily by two major mobile network operators: Batelco and Zain, both of which provide extensive 4G coverage and are in the process of rolling out 5G services. As of 2023, approximately 99% of the population has access to mobile phones, reflecting the high penetration rate in a country with a population of about 1.5 million. Bahrainโ€™s telecommunications framework is further supported by the presence of the Telecommunications Regulatory Authority (TRA), which ensures fair competition and promotes technological advancement. Landline services are also prevalent, although mobile phones are the preferred mode of communication for many residents. The country has made significant investments in enhancing its telecommunications capabilities, aiming to keep pace with global advancements in technology.

Dialing Bahrain from Abroad

To make an international call to Bahrain, start by dialing your country's international access code. For example, in the United States, this is 011. Next, enter Bahrain's country code, which is +973. Following the country code, you will dial the local number, which typically consists of 8 digits. Bahrain does not have distinct area codes; instead, the local number format is uniform across the country. When dialing a mobile number from abroad, the format remains the same as that for landlines. However, it's important to ensure you omit any leading zeros in the local number if they exist. For example, if the number is 17XXXXXX, simply dial it as 17XXXXXX after the country code. Be aware that calling from mobile to mobile or landline to landline will not require different prefixes, simplifying the dialing process.

Best Times to Call Bahrain from Surat

Bahrain operates on Arabian Standard Time (AST), which is UTC+3. This means that when scheduling calls, itโ€™s essential to consider the time difference from your location. The standard business hours in Bahrain are typically from 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M, Sunday through Thursday, aligning with the Islamic workweek, as Friday and Saturday constitute the weekend. When planning calls, it is advisable to avoid national holidays such as Eid al-Fitr and Eid al-Adha, when many businesses close for extended periods. Additionally, during the month of Ramadan, working hours may shift, and many professionals may prefer to schedule calls later in the day post-iftar, the evening meal that breaks the fast. Personal call windows are often flexible, but calling in the early evening is generally a safe choice.

Calling Etiquette in Bahrain

In Bahrain, phone call etiquette tends to reflect the countryโ€™s blend of modern and traditional values. When answering a call, it is common for individuals to greet the caller with โ€œHelloโ€ or โ€œAs-salamu alaykumโ€ (peace be upon you) for a more formal touch. This duality in greeting styles is indicative of Bahrainโ€™s multicultural environment, with both Arabic and English widely used. Cold calling is generally less accepted in business settings compared to personal contacts, where friends and family may call without prior notice. In professional contexts, it is advisable to schedule calls ahead of time, especially for more formal discussions. Preferred communication channels may vary; while phone calls are acceptable for immediate matters, emails often serve as the initial touchpoint for business communications, providing a written record and time for consideration.

Reading Bahrain Phone Numbers

Bahrain's numbering plan is unusually clean: all numbers are eight digits with no area code distinctions. Mobiles typically start with 3, landlines with 1 or 6. Batelco and Zain both operate mobile networks, and a 3-prefix number usually belongs to one of them. The island is small and mobile coverage is essentially complete, so mobiles are the primary point of contact for most residents. Landlines are common in corporate offices and government ministries, and calling a 1-prefix fixed line during business hours is the most reliable way to reach a department rather than an individual. Numbers starting with 8 are often special services; treat any 8-prefix number with caution when calling from outside the country, as they may not connect or may route unexpectedly.

Saving on Regular Calls to Bahrain

Bahrain's working week runs Sunday to Thursday โ€” a common miscalculation for callers used to a Monday start. Calls on Friday or Saturday go to personal time, and even senior professionals are unlikely to pick up for business matters. The time zone is Gulf Standard Time, UTC+3, with no daylight saving adjustment. During Ramadan, office hours typically shorten to around six hours per day, often with a later start, and the window for productive calls narrows; calling after iftar in the evening can work better for personal contacts. Landlines are generally cheaper to reach than mobiles from abroad, so routing calls to a company's fixed line rather than a personal mobile is the simplest way to reduce cost on frequent business calls.
